Output de6d7aaff7a8dccf855072a2e3acee5e5d63d270f2943d65efbaefc711fc843a:90

value
128524938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997ff9f61a44abcb35f1eac2d3d0294216a33343 OP_EQUAL
address
3FgecrJDv9iHzkGqMgjFPazgdACKDf55w3
transaction
de6d7aaff7a8dccf855072a2e3acee5e5d63d270f2943d65efbaefc711fc843a
spent
true